Status 800 means the registration was renewed after acceptable combined Section 8 and Section 9 filings. The mark remains registered for another 10-year term with active federal protection. Calendar the next Section 8 and 9 deadline in 10 years and maintain monitoring.

| Nov 27, 2012 | R.SR | REGISTERED-SUPPLEMENTAL REGISTER | Your mark is registered on the Supplemental Register, which is available for marks that are not yet distinctive enough for the Principal Register but can still identify a source. Protection is more limited than Principal Register registration but can later support a Principal Register application. |
